About the White-tailed Cotinga
The White-tailed Cotinga (Xipholena lamellipennis) is a species of bird in the Cotingas family (Cotingidae), within the order Passeriformes. This family contains 65 recognized species worldwide.
Use the eBird species code whtcot1 when logging sightings in eBird or other citizen science platforms.
